YouTube has become so big, that it may become irrelevant as consumers seek more focused affinity-based sharing sites, Bill Cleary suggested yesterday at OnHollywood. Some panelists countered that it will retain value as a search-based library, but may not fulfill the growing demand microniche sites, a new hotspot in the online media world.
